Alternatively you can also use the centos.plus kernel to get support for
tuner cards and other "multimedia" devices.

Here's info how to get started with Centos Plus:
http://wiki.centos.org/AdditionalResources/Repositories/CentOSPlus

I only use that repo for the kernel packages using the exclude and include
options described in that same link.
